About Pearl Toby Puffer
A small, stocky pufferfish with a blunt rounded head and smooth skin. Coloration is tan to yellowish-brown with prominent white or pearl-colored spots covering the head and body, and a dark eye-stripe. The belly is typically lighter colored.
Key facts
- Care Requirements
- • Minimum 30-gallon aquarium, preferably larger • Stable water: pH 8.1–8.3, salinity 1.023–1.025, temp 72–78°F • Varied meaty diet (mysis, copepods, small crustaceans) • Hiding spots and live rock for security • May nip or consume invertebrates and small fish
- Min tank size
- 30 gallons
- Diet
- carnivore
- Feeding Schedule
- 2-3 times daily
- Origin
- Indo-Pacific region from East Africa and the Red Sea eastward to the central Pacific, including Indonesia, Philippines, and Micronesia.
- Reef safety
- Not Reef Safe
- Care Level
- Moderate
- Temperament
- Semi Aggressive
- Difficulty Level
- Moderate - Requires some experience due to specific dietary water or tank requirements. Best suited for intermediate aquarists.
- Family
- Tetraodontidae
- Diet Details
- Feed small meaty foods including mysis shrimp, copepods, small crustaceans, and quality frozen preparations. These fish are specialized predators on small invertebrates and benefit from varied live or frozen foods that encourage natural feeding behavior.
- Water Parameters
- Temperature: 72-79°F pH: 8.1-8.3 Salinity: 1.02-1.025
